HOWEVER, there is a chance that some people might be surprised or worried, since this "smells" like a typical internet "trojan" attack vector. (I think there was some uproar about this in the past.)

IIRC, Apple used this for some ReadMe file on an install CD. I haven't read somewhere about people being surprised (and this would be the same persons that are offended with the DRM-Free songs).

Ah yes, many Apple "Read Me" type files are actually .apps that launch to show the correct language version of the file based on the user's language preferences.
